IEEE Germany Section Spotlight: IEEE Student Branch Ilmenau

The IEEE Student Branch at Technische Universität Ilmenau has grown into one of the most active student communities within IEEE in Germany. Founded in late 2007 and officially established in January 2008, the branch connects students early in their academic journey with a global professional network and provides a platform for both personal and technical development.

With around 30 active members, the branch not only contributes locally but also maintains strong connections with other student branches and partners across Germany and beyond.

In recognition of their outstanding contributions, active engagement, and strong leadership, the IEEE Student Branch Ilmenau has been awarded the IEEE Regional Exemplary Student Branch Award 2025 by IEEE Region 8. This award highlights the branch’s dedication to fostering innovation, professional growth, and meaningful impact within the global IEEE community.
